After a cancelled shakedown and delays to their new F1 car's arrival which cost them two-and-a-half crucial days of pre-season running, Williams finally hit the track with their Mercedes-powered FW42 on Wednesday. Rookie George Russell was the driver tasked with completing the new machine’s very first lap, which you can watch above.
